The question buyers actually ask about Christmas art is a practical one: is a canvas worth owning for the five or six weeks a year it hangs? With vintage styles the answer is stronger than for most seasonal work, because the appeal is only half about Christmas. Faded reds, aged paper tones, mid-century illustration and old-poster typography carry a general nostalgia that reads as decor first and holiday second, so the piece earns its storage space in a way a glossy cartoon Santa never will.

Vintage palettes are also why this category settles into real homes so easily. Muted crimson, forest green, cream and gold sit comfortably beside ordinary furniture, where modern high-saturation Christmas graphics clash with everything except tinsel. If your decorations lean traditional — real greenery, warm lights, wooden ornaments — the aged look will match them without effort.

Placement during the season is straightforward: above the mantel if you have one, in the entryway if you do not, or swapped in where an everyday piece normally hangs. That swap is the tidy trick of seasonal canvas — same hook, same spot, a five-minute changeover, and the room resets in January without a blank wall ever appearing.

For the other ten months, treat storage kindly: somewhere dry, upright rather than flat under boxes, wrapped against dust, and away from attic temperature swings if you can manage it. A canvas stored well looks new every December; one crushed under the decorations box does not.

When choosing between designs, favour scenes over slogans. A vintage sleigh scene or a snowy village stays charming across years of Decembers; text-heavy pieces, however handsome the lettering, are jokes that must land every single year. The quiet image outlasts the loud caption — in this category more than any other.
